Aventia Strengthens Environmental Solutions with St.Germain Acquisition

Aventia Enhances Its Environmental Services Portfolio Through St.Germain Acquisition



Aventia, a premier platform in environmental services, has recently made headlines with its acquisition of St.Germain, a consulting firm known for its robust expertise in regulatory compliance and environmental engineering. The deal, announced on February 12, 2025, signifies a strategic move for Aventia, which aims to broaden its service offerings and enhance its operational footprint across the United States.

Headquartered in Maine, St.Germain specializes in a wide range of services, including site remediation, hydrogeological investigation, and hazardous waste management. These capabilities complement Aventia's existing suite of environmental solutions, allowing for a richer array of services tailored to meet the evolving demands of public and private sector clients. Notably, St.Germain also offers Sentry EHS®, an online compliance management tool that will be integrated into Aventia's operations to provide clients with enhanced monitoring and reporting functionalities.

Background and Significance of the Acquisition



Founded in 1992, St.Germain has built a strong reputation in the environmental consulting arena, serving various industries predominantly within New England. The firm not only focuses on compliance and engineering but has also demonstrated significant expertise in energy and petroleum management, site planning, and environmental health and safety strategies. This acquisition marks Aventia’s fourth since its inception as a rebranded entity in 2022, previously known as Environmental Systems Group, under the ownership of Bernhard Capital Partners.

Bernhard Capital’s mission to create robust environmental solutions is further supported through this acquisition, bringing together substantial resources from both companies. Dirk Applegate, the CEO of Aventia, expressed enthusiasm regarding the union, citing that St.Germain’s commitment to environmental excellence and sector experience align perfectly with Aventia’s mission.
